  1. Upcoming Release of GroupDocs.Metadata for Java

    We are happy to announce that GroupDocs.Metadata is coming soon to Java Platform. It will be a back-end API that will allow you to work with metadata associated with various file formats including documents, images, audios, videos, zip, emails and many more. The API aims to facilitate its users with simple syntax, easy to use methods and few lines of code to perform metadata operations.   2. Changing Target File Format | GroupDocs

    Note This feature is supported by version 18.9. or greater Note The code uses some of the objects defined in The Business Layer. Changing Target File Format GroupDocs.Assembly provides a powerful feature to change the target file format of an assembled document using file extension or explicit specifying.
